For decades, the US was a rotten, diseased, pirate nation in the eyes of North Koreas propagandists. Then almost overnight the hate stopped.
Following a landmark summit between Pyongyang and Washington on June 12, anti-US vitriol has disappeared from state media reports a development that some analysts see as preparing North Koreans for a new era in relations between the two long-time adversaries.
The anti-American slant is just gone. North Korea appears to be preparing people for a new beginning, said Peter Ward, an expert at Seoul National University who studies the Norths propaganda.
The changes in Pyongyangs rhetoric will bolster hopes of those, including US president Donald Trump, who believe that North Korean leader Kim Jong Un is sincere about reorienting his reclusive nation back into the international community.
When the two leaders met in Singapore last week, they pledged a new future and since then the overtures have been positive.
On Tuesday, Washington nixed long-running military exercises that irked Pyongyang. North Korea, for its part, appears set to repatriate the remains of US servicemen killed during the Korean war in the 1950s.
Scepticism persists, however, that North Korea is using the becalmed atmosphere to push for sanctions relief and has not actually moved towards the ostensible goal of the Singapore summit: the regimes denuclearisation....
